Thanks David! Well, I guess I could have said "the horsemen are approaching..." for...

but...I guess I just didn't feel like it man.

Bob Dylan was always inventing his own apocalyptic landscapes and didn't seem to care if it was exact as long as it sounded good, so I said, heck, I can too!

Besides, I didn't say horsemen, I said riders, and I think the number Seven is scarier.

Plus, I said the FIRST Apocalypse which is the one that is happening NOW ahead of time, where in the Snyder mythology, there are Seven Riders.

Some have asked if these are the Seven Deadly sins, which can all be attributed to one famous person, or an allusion to the Seven Celtic Kingdoms which are coming to seek bloody vengeance for the destruction of their villages and Celtic grave sites to build golf courses. Will there be a movie on Netflix called the Seventh Kingdom where we see a Celtic battleaxe covered in blood and weird hair lying on a golf course in the opening shot??

Others wanted to know if it refers to the Seven Vestal Virgins.

Band-in-a-Box 2026 for Windows is Here!

Band-in-a-Box® 2026 for Windows is here and it is packed with major new features! There’s a new modern look, a GUI redesign to all areas of the program including toolbars, windows, workflow and more. There’s a Multi-view layout for organizing multiple windows. A standout addition is the powerful AI-Notes feature, which uses AI neural-net technology to transcribe polyphonic audio into MIDI—entire mixes or individual instruments—making it easy to study, view, and play parts from any song. And that’s just the beginning—there are over 60 new features in this exciting release.
